## Authentication — TrailLedger Viewer

The audit-log viewer reads from the Granary event store via the internal Sentry-Gate proxy. No anonymous access; every request carries a service key in the X-Ledger-Auth header. Keys scope to read-only and expire every 60 days. The viewer refuses to start without a valid key in its environment. Reviewer note: confirm the middleware strips the header before logging. For local verification against staging, use the key that follows.

gateway credential: kto7_GoY89Me

## Deployment

Fareloom's rules engine evaluates shipping-fee rules in an isolated worker pool. Rule definitions are signed before load; unsigned rules are rejected at startup. No outbound network access is permitted from evaluators. Deploys are immutable images, config injected at boot. For review purposes, the production configuration applied to each evaluator instance is reproduced below.

service settings:
[casax]
port = 6379
team = rusir
host = casax.zemvarhq.corp
region = outer-4
access_code = ac_9808ce
timeout_ms = 1500

Quarterly Planning Note — Halvorn Term Sheet

Finance team: Halvorn Dynamics submitted its term sheet for the co-development deal last week. Key points: three-year exclusivity on the Skyward sensor line, 8% royalty, milestone payments totalling a mid-seven-figure sum. Legal flags the exclusivity clause as too broad; we will counter. Cash impact modelled under scenarios A and B, circulated separately. Decision due by quarter close. The confidential negotiating position is noted below.

board note of kageg-bahof: The renewal with Holwynax Holdings closes at $2 million a year, 5 percent below the last contract. Project Ulaath slips by two quarters because of the supplier delay.

Present: senior management, finance liaison.

The revised commission scheme for Marquand Supply was approved. Key points: flat 4% replaced by a tiered structure; clawback applies to cancelled orders within 90 days; the Redfern product line is excluded pending margin review. Finance to model payout scenarios by month-end and update accrual assumptions. Rollout communications go to branches after the modeling is complete. Members then discussed strategic context, recorded in the confidential note below.

confidential, bahap-bajog: Zorethix Works is in early talks to buy Kelethox Foods for about $30.7 million. The Ralvan launch date is September 19, and nothing goes to the press before then.